Former offices which housed a solicitors company could become flats, with plans submitted to transform the part of the building in central Reading.

Plans have been submitted to convert part of St Laurence House, 10-12 The Forbury, from offices into five flats, seeking permission for the change of use.

The three-storey building is in a conservation area and is next to a mixed-use building known as Sussex House.

There are flats on the upper floors, with the vacant former EJ Winter & Sons LLP Solicitors on the ground floor.

St Laurence House overlooks the Churchyard of St Laurence Church.

The whole building will become flats if the plans are approved.
